#ce6dee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ce6dee is composed of 80.8% red, 42.7%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.4%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 285.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 68%. #ce6dee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#9d00dd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#ce6dee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ce6dee has RGB values of R:206, G:109,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 13528558.

Hex triplet ce6dee #ce6dee
RGB Decimal 206, 109, 238 rgb(206,109,238)
RGB Percent 80.8, 42.7, 93.3 rgb(80.8%,42.7%,93.3%)
CMYK 13, 54, 0, 7
HSL 285.1°, 79.1, 68 hsl(285.1,79.1%,68%)
HSV (or HSB) 285.1°, 54.2, 93.3
Web Safe cc66ff #cc66ff
CIE-LAB 61.855, 57.981, -49.399
XYZ 46.353, 30.234, 84.278
xyY 0.288, 0.188, 30.234
CIE-LCH 61.855, 76.171, 319.57
CIE-LUV 61.855, 38.993, -85.904
Hunter-Lab 54.985, 54.253, -52.387
Binary 11001110, 01101101, 11101110

Shades and Tints of #ce6dee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010c is the darkest color, while #fdfafe is the lightest one.
